What is genetic drift?<br><br> Please help me with this ill mark you as brainlist.
zlopas [31]

Genetic drift is a mechanism of evolution in which allele frequencies of a population change over generations due to chance (sampling error).

Genetic drift occurs in all populations of non-infinite size, but its effects are strongest in small populations.

Genetic drift can have major effects when a population is sharply reduced in size by a natural disaster (bottleneck effect) or when a small group splits off from the main population to found a colony (founder effect).

Cystic fibrosis is the most common lethal genetic disorder in Caucasians. Individuals who are homozygous recessive for this trai
Gnoma [55]

Answer:

heterozygote advantage

Explanation:

An heterozygote advantage is when a heterozygous genotype has a greater aptitude than homozygous genotypes. The specific case of heterozygous advantage over a single locus is known as overdominance. In short, this happens when a disorder is present in a heterozygous population, but this disorder has a great benefit for the genes present in the body.
